It has been a good winter for us.  Took the black #1114 NATIONAL CHAMPI0N, and almost-fastest-Maxton-nitrous bike home to Tallahassee for the winter.

Found that the stock motor was only good for a dyno RWHP of about 150, but the nitrous was good for an additional 117 HP, or 267 RWHP.

Figured that since the nitrous "loves" compression, that the high compression pistons, mild head work and better cams and valves would be enough to boost the stock moter to over 210 HP.  Figured right.

With 210 HP on gasoline, and 117 from the nitrous, we should be able to make 327 RWHP with the current nitrous setup, with another 30HP in nitrous jets "for emergency use only!"

Not a problem Ken,  And Wayne, wouldn't that be a hoot you beating my records with my own bike.  Yikes!!!  If anyone can do it, You da man.  I want to try my hand on one of those 400hp+turbo's in the Guthrie stables.  

I just finished fitting the new low-cf tank and Nitrous system configuration.  I should have it on the dyno this weekend for the final tune-ups. I have developed some new nitrous injectors using waterjet technology to drill the orifaces in the ruby tips.  Atomizing the fuel was a problem but we used some high speed stop actions to capture what the injector was doing at different fuel pressures and output angles of the spray in relation to the nitrous ports in the injector.  

Also trying some new fuels for the N2O.  It's nice to have a dyno inhouse to do these things.  We cinged a head in the process but that is what it takes to R&D stuff like this.  You have given me the incentive to be the fastest on the juice.  Everyone else is using those safe old turbo's     to get HP.  But no, we do it the old fashioned way, we burn sh_t up.    

I'm also playing with cryogenics and thermal barrier coatings on components.  I'm spending way too much, this is sick.

Guy:  I have found that I might need a 10 pound bottle.  Have you been successful with the pair of "sidesaddle" tanks?

Offline 2fast4u2c

  • Site Supporter
  • Mad Post Whore
  • ****
  • Posts: 2667
  • Gender: Male
  • 300mph or bust in 1 mile
    • Tiger Racing Products
*** MAXTON *** March 27-28
« Reply #19 on: January 21, 2004, 02:19:00 PM »
If I remember Waynes bike, he had the 10lb bottle tucked very neatly under the rear.  The sidesaddle 2lb'ers so far have done very nicely in keeping the pressure up for the 18 sec with the larger jetting.  With the single 2lb'er, I was going from 950lb at launch to 625lb at end.  I was using 1lb 4oz at every run.  I have been using static testing only but when I depleted the 2 bottles of 1lb 4oz, my pressure only dropped 100lbs which I can deal with in my progressive controller.  I'm going to take the chance with the side saddles and hope that my thigh covers them enough to allow the wind to brush by them. That 10lb'er has got to be heavy.
